Job Purpose: As a WEM Tester, you will safely pressure and/or leak test grey iron, ductile iron, steel and stainless-steel castings, while following all Work Instructions. You will be required to maintain the highest level of quality and report results accurately.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
Assemble parts for loading on testing bench.
Visually examine parts for defects such as cracks and pin holes.
Measures results of pressure test and logs data.
Separates and marks defective parts according to job specifications and department procedures.
Files/deburrs surplus metal from parts as needed.
Accurately stamp parts after successful completion of test.
Disassembles parts after testing is complete.
Tag & move parts to staging area for storage.
Prepare proper work order/routing documentation.
Tests boilers, tanks, fittings, pipes, and similar objects to detect and locate leaks, using compressed air or water pressure: Installs fittings on object to seal outlets and connects object to high-pressure air or water line, using hand tools.
Activates air compressor or water pump until gauge registers specified internal pressure.
Observes gauge for loss of pressure indicative of leaks and examines object for escaping air or water to detect leaks.
Marks object at source of leaks for subsequent repair.
May apply soap solution to surface of object or immerse object to facilitate location of air leaks.
May test object under high pressure to ensure compliance with product safety ratings.
May be designated according to type of test used as Hydrostatic Tester; Pneumatic Tester.

How much does a quality assurance tester earn in La Crosse, WI?
The average quality assurance tester in La Crosse, WI earns between $49,000 and $87,000 annually. This compares to the national average quality assurance tester range of $55,000 to $99,000.
